Avalanche Summary

You can trigger an avalanche where recently drifted snow forms cohesive slabs at upper elevations. The most dangerous slopes face the north half of the compass where drifted snow stacks above shallow, buried weak layers. On these slopes, avalanches that fail in the upper snowpack could possibly step down into deeper weak layers, creating a larger and more dangerous avalanche.

Stiff, hollow-sounding wind drifts that crack underneath you or your snowmachine indicate you have found a slab of drifted snow, and you should avoid slopes steeper than about 35 degrees. This week's strong winds formed big overhanging cornices along ridgelines. Give cornices a wide berth as they can break further back than you expect.
